Collector asks officials to submit plans for the celebrations

May 28, 2015 12:00 am | Updated 06:00 am IST - WARANGAL:

The District Collector has directed the mandal-level officers and Joint Action Committees to submit their plans for the State Formation Day celebrations.

Collector Vakati Karuna said Warangal district being an important place in Telangana Sate, people expect grand celebrations and hence there should be a proper plan. The State Formation Day celebrations would begin from midnight of June 1. All the officers, NGOs and JACs should submit their plans by June 28.

The district administration plans to conduct Swachh Bharat on June 5 and all divisional level officers should observe it on grand scale.

Floral tributes

One June 2, the national flag should be unfurled between 7a.m. and 8 a.m. at all offices and by 8 a.m., people should gather at Telangana Martyrs Memorial and pay floral tributes to those who died fighting for Telangana cause. All employees should come in a rally. The Keerti Thoranams, the symbol of

Kakatiya kingdom at all four corners of the district borders should be lighted up and in towns, all public places and important buildings should be lit up. On June 6 and 7, all the departments should plan for competitions and medical camps. A massive rally should be planned on June 7.
